Of course, there are many other ways of enjoying Christmas this year without sticking some mini wreaths on ya nipples. In fact, you should probably get into the festive spirit nice and early - as doing so apparently makes for happier people.

According to psychoanalyst Steve McKeown, those who get their Christmas on sooner rather than later are generally more excited by life, and that the nostalgia of getting all the decorations out takes us back to those care-free days when we were kids.

via GIPHY

McKeown told Unilad: "Although there could be a number of symptomatic reasons why someone would want to obsessively put up decorations early, most commonly for nostalgic reasons either to relive the magic or to compensate for past neglect.

"In a world full of stress and anxiety people like to associate to things that make them happy and Christmas decorations evoke those strong feelings of their childhood.

"Decorations are simply an anchor or pathway to those old childhood magical emotions of excitement. So putting up those Christmas decorations early extend the excitement!"

All that festive nostalgia can also remind us of memories of loved ones no longer with us.

McKeown continued: "It may be a bittersweet feeling. Perhaps the holidays serve as a reminder of when a loved one was still alive. Or maybe looking at a Christmas tree reminds someone of what life was like when they still believed in Santa."
